Temperature-Controlled Drying Cost in Cranston, RI

The cost of Temperature-Controlled Drying services in Cranston, RI,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Temperature-Controlled Drying services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Extraction and drying $500-$2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ed
Temperature-controlled drying $1,000-$5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ed
Moisture testing and inspection $200-$1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Dehumidification and ventilation $500-$2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ed
Final inspection and certification $100-$500 Size of affected area, equipment needed

The prices listed above are estimates and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ates for all our services, so you can get a more accurate quote for your Temperature-Controlled Drying needs in Cranston, RI.
